Recognizing Cold Laser Therapy
Cold laser therapy, additionally called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a cutting-edge approach to hair reconstruction that takes advantage of specific wavelengths of light to stimulate hair follicles. This non-invasive therapy promotes hair growth by improving cellular activity and improving blood circulation in the scalp.
When you undertake this treatment, you'll observe that the low-level laser light passes through the skin, energizing the hair follicles and urging them to go into the development phase of the hair cycle.
You may wonder exactly how this process works. The light emitted throughout the therapy turns on the mitochondria within your cells, boosting energy production and promoting the recovery process. Because of this, your roots can recover from any damages, causing much healthier hair development.
This treatment is generally painless and requires no downtime, making it a hassle-free choice for several people looking for hair restoration.
Routine sessions can assist you attain the very best outcomes, as consistency is type in reaping the benefits of cold laser therapy. With each session, you're providing your hair follicles the support they require to grow, causing thicker, fuller hair over time.

Suggested Therapy Routines
When preparing your treatment routine for hair remediation, uniformity is key to achieving ideal outcomes. Most experts recommend starting with three sessions weekly for the very first month. look here kickstart the hair restoration procedure by promoting hair roots and promoting circulation in the scalp.
As you proceed, you can gradually lower the frequency to 2 sessions each week for the following a couple of months. This modification permits your scalp to continue benefiting from the therapy while providing you some adaptability in your schedule.
After this first duration, numerous find that once-a-week sessions can maintain the results you've accomplished, specifically if you're combining cold laser treatment with various other hair repair strategies.
